selenium - HtmlUnitDriver पृष्ठ ठीक से नहीं हो रहा है




webdriver htmlunit-driver (2)

जावास्क्रिप्ट अक्षम google.com होने के लिए HtmlUnitDriver डिफ़ॉल्ट जावास्क्रिप्ट पर भारी निर्भर करता है। driver.setJavascriptEnabled(true) कोशिश करें driver.setJavascriptEnabled(true)

WebDriver driver = new HtmlUnitDriver();
driver.setJavascriptEnabled(true)
driver.get("http://www.google.com");
System.out.println(driver.getPageSource());

मैं इस पर एक नौसिखिया हूं, मूल रूप से मैं एचटीएमएलयूएनआईटीड्रिवर का इस्तेमाल करने की कोशिश कर रहा हूं, यह मेरा कोड है:

WebDriver driver = new HtmlUnitDriver();
driver.get("http://www.google.com");
System.out.println(driver.getPageSource());

लेकिन मेरे पास पेज स्रोत है:

<?xml version="1.0" encoding="UTF-8"?>
<html>
  <head/>
  <body/>
</html>

मैंने नए HtmlUnitDriver (सच) की कोशिश की है, लेकिन यह अब भी Google लोड नहीं कर रहा है, मैं पहले से ही सेलेनियम सर्वर क्लास पथ में अकेले खड़ा है। क्या मैं गलत हूं? धन्यवाद

पीएसः इमेल सेलेनियम-सर्वर स्टैंडअलोन-2.24.1.जर और जेआर 1.7 का उपयोग कर रहा है


Htmlunitdriver शुरू करने के दौरान समस्या निश्चित रूप से प्रॉक्सी के कारण लापता है आपको प्रॉक्सी विवरण प्रदान करना होगा







htmlunit-driver